开始专题提供开始的最新资讯内容,帮你更好的了解开始。
我来自C#背景,用来编程来控制所有低级的东西(微控制器和硬件相关的东西).我刚换了工作,需要学习编程Dynamics NAV.我一生都没有使用数据库繁重的应用程序,所以整个学习体验对我来说非常令人沮丧. 问题: >任何新手友好的网站,以便我可以从零学习C / AL? >我可以去的任何网站都有可以复制和学习的小项目,ala CodeProject? (CodeProject的一些东西足够小,可以用于
如果图片挂了,请访问:http://www.jianshu.com/p/d989cf2453dd 正则表达式是描述一组字符串特征的模式,用来匹配特定的字符串. –Ken Thompson 虽然有点抽秀,但是我觉得大家已经模模糊糊的明白了. 你应该有的工具 为了直观的看到你的对错,请使用网站在线正则测试 最笨的”匹配” 我的上一个手机号码是 18615654686,当然,作为天朝子民,前面是有个+8
一些细节的完善 在上篇文章中,我们简单使用了一个正则完成了一些东西,但是也发现了一些问题.那个在线工具并不怎么好用… 经常遇到输入之后,没有匹配. 这也是 web 程序经常遇到的尴尬.所以,我们使用本地应用来进行处理. 笔者的是 mac10.10 ,使用的工具叫做 RegExRx .大家可以选择一款合适的使用.( windows 下的正则程序更加多,功能也很强大) 开始正则之旅 明确了正则的用途之
转自http://blog.csdn.net/lxcnn/article/details/4268033 1       概述 正则表达式(Regular Expression)是一种匹配模式,描述的是一串文本的特征。 正如自然语言中“高大”、“坚固”等词语抽象出来描述事物特征一样,正则表达式就是字符的高度抽象,用来描述字符串的特征。 正则表达式(以下简称正则,Regex)通常不独立存在,各种编程
如下,匹配以“http”开头的整行字符串 ^http.*$ 如下匹配任意含http的整行 ^.*http.*$
【转】正则表达式匹配行的开始'^'和结尾'$'   2013-04-02 20:21:25|  分类: 正则表达式|举报|字号 订阅           下载LOFTER 我的照片书  | <转自: http://www.pin5i.com/showtopic-21204.html > 行的开始和结束 开始符号:^ 结束符号:$  如:^cat 应该理解为以c作为一行的第一个字符,紧接着是a,然后
^[a-z\d_]{4,40}$    ^表示开始,a-z表示小写字母a到z,\d表示全部数字,_表示可是特殊字符_,[]表示全部,{4,40}表示4到40个字符,$结束。 整体规则是:英文数字(小写字母)或者下划线,在4-40个字符以内。
这是一篇简单介绍正则表达式的博客,从零开始学正则,简单易懂。 首先   我们编写处理字符串的程序或网页时会用到正则表达式,它就是记录文本规则的代码。 举个栗子,大家应该都知道通配符的概念,windows下查找一个word文档你会搜索*.doc,那么,*就是一个任意的字符串,和通配符类似。正则表达式就和这有一些相似,只不过比那种搜索更精准,可以满足你的需求。   入门   我们从栗子开始。 假设你在
今天在整理MvvmCross(c# mvvm跨平台框架)文档做epub电子书时,遇到到了文字显示不太好,需要去掉指定开头的字符串。 然后写了下面这个正则表达式 正则表达式 <a id="user.+</a>可以匹配下面高亮这段文本 <h1 style="box-sizing: border-box; margin: 24px 0px 16px; line-height: 1.25; padding
关于正则表达式,当我们了解它就不难,不了解就很难,其实任何事情都是这样,没有人一生下来就啥都会,说白了,每个人都是一个学习了解进步的过程。学习和掌握正则表达式可能并不是太简单,因为它确实是有点像“外星语”。      为什么要用正则表达式 市面上很早就有关于正则表达式的专业技术书记,在软件开发、性能测试、自动化测试、测试开发中都可以看到正则表达式优美的舞姿。 对于静态文本内容, 因为有提供与预期的
删除S 之后的所有字符用:s.*$ 删除S 之前的所有字符用:^([^s]*)s 如果是其他字符就把s替换为其他字符 参考网址:https://zhidao.baidu.com/question/328466757201619245.html
/^[a-zA-Z\u4e00-\u9fa5][a-zA-Z0-9\u4e00-\u9fa5_\-\s]*$/.test(value)匹配汉字、英文字母、数字、下划线、杠、空格,并且只能以汉字或英文字母开头 例:章-z_2 1   /^[0-9]+([.]\d{1,2})?$/.test(value) 匹配数字,最高保留两位小数. 例: 0.12 或 12.32    ...
前言 之前一直想要做一个自己的爬虫,然后从nba数据相关的网上【虎扑,腾讯,官网等,要视网站是否支持】爬点数据写数据分析和图形化展示。虽然年轻的时候就实现过这个功能,但是当时直接借用了一个网上现成的jar包,然后在那个基础上写了一个非常简陋的正则表达式来提取数据。这次打算自己用JAVA API写一个爬虫,里面除了能读取HTML或是JSON或是XML,还要能够相应的支持多线程【这个功能将最后完成】。
一、元字符 “^” :^字符串的起始位置。 “$” :$会匹配字符串的结尾 文本: hello world! 正则: ^hello w 结果: 文本:hello world 正则:ld$ 结果: “\b” :不会消耗任何字符只匹配一个位置,例子中匹配出is所在的位置 文本:this is a test 正则:\bis\b 效果图: “\d”: 匹配数字 文本:1362228888 正则:\d\d\
一些有用的正则的尝试和收集: 以下是以js规则的表达式 1、匹配中文 var s = '我爱中国'; var reg = /[\u4e00-\u9fa5]/; var result = s.match(reg); 匹配结果: ["我", index: 0, input: "我爱中国"] // 全局匹配 var reg = /[\u4e00-\u9fa5]/g; var result = s.mat
文章作者:Tyan 博客:noahsnail.com  |  CSDN  |  简书 注:本文为李沐大神的《动手学深度学习》的课程笔记! 高维线性回归 使用线性函数 y=0.05+∑pi=10.01xi+noise y = 0.05 + ∑ i = 1 p 0.01 x i + noise 生成数据样本,噪音服从均值0和标准差为0.01的正态分布。 # 导入mxnet import random
我正在使用Sublime Text在Windows上编辑批处理文件。我想删除所有不是从ECHO或REM开始的行。我认为这可以用正则表达式进行,但是我无法理解。任何人? 从我可以理解,Sublime Text使用Python的正则表达式引擎。 此代码匹配所有不以ECHO和REM开头的行: ^(?!(?:ECHO|REM)).*\s*
我试着用“(”)替换行的开头,但是当我使用替换我不能这样做. 例如: 432425\n 4254645\n w4546746\n 46457367\n 4765756\n 我希望输出使用全部替换 所以我使用^符号与正则表达式选择和全部替换. 仅使用替换工作正常. (432425\n (4254645\n (w4546746\n (46457367\n (4765756\n 不是解决方案,而是解决办
我有以下 XML标签 <list message="2 < 3"> 我想替换<在& lt 需要一个正则表达式来匹配<如果它没有出现在行的开头. [^<] =一个或多个不是< < =<你在找 更换: ([^<]+)< 有: $1<
我有一个字符串 str = c("F14 : M114L","W15 : M116L, W15 : M118L","W15 : D111L, F14 : E112L, F14 : M116L") 目的是删除:和L之间的任何东西(也包括在前面的空格),以便我最终会有 "F14", "W15, W15", "W15, F14, F14" 我在想用 gsub(" : [[:alnum:]]L", "",